“Fame” is a song by Jamaican singer-songwriter Grace Jones from her second studio album of the same name (1978). It was released in 1978, by Island Records as the album’s second single. Produced by Tom Moulton, “Fame” was originally part of a 20 minute medley on the “Fame” LP. On this 12″ promo “Fame” is presented in it’s edited form.

The song was not a hit on the pop charts but was huge in the dance clubs reaching the #3 position.
